Output 8e305fd87c3819a890377b55543599acd475fbba93278f17d346fd5d427b5780:0

value
23842066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579b4123768cf111613a7b972cfe9375a6cedec8 OP_EQUAL
address
39gEhW21fiDrZK95CH8jRuSZNdbnNEETUq
transaction
8e305fd87c3819a890377b55543599acd475fbba93278f17d346fd5d427b5780